ORLANDO FOOT & ANKLE CLINIC is categorized under PHYSICIANS & SURGEONS and located at 2111 Glenwood Dr. Ste. 104 32792 in or near the Winter Park, FL area. Call (407) 647-1550 . Fax (407) 647-1561 .
Find additional information including website, email, map, and directions - orlandofootandankle.com.
Ready to advertise and become a part of our network?
Click here for advertising information on The Original YP Network®